
School Counselor (.40 FTE) - Branciforte Middle School at Santa Cruz City Schools
Job Summary
Job Summary
Under the supervision of the site principal, provide a full range of professional student services utilizing leadership, advocacy, and collaboration to promote student success, provide preventive services, and respond to identified student needs; implement a comprehensive school counseling program that addresses academic, career, and personal/social development for all students.
Requirements / Qualifications
This position requires a valid California Pupil Personnel Services Credential for School Counseling. Bilingual/bicultural (Spanish) preferred.
